Answer:
mRT = 4√13 ≈ 14.42
mST = 10√2 ≈ 14.14
Step-by-step explanation:
Pythagorean Theorem: a² + b² = c²
Since we have right triangles, in order to find the missing side, we use Pythagorean Theorem:
mTR:
12² + 8² = c²
144 + 64 = c²
c² = 208
c = √208 = 4√13
mST:
15² = 5² + b²
225 - 25 = b²
b² = 200
b = √200 = 10√2
To get your decimals, simply evaluate the square roots:
4√13 = 14.4222
10√2 = 14.1421
